Esslemont Road is in Southsea and in Portsmouth district. PO4 0ES is located in the Central Southsea elect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Portsmouth South.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ding PO4 0ES,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 53%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Partnership Status

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.

In the immediate area around PO4 0ES, a significant portion of the population is single, making up 54.5% of the residents. On average, approximately 38% of individuals who responded to the census in the UK were single. Areas with higher single populations are typically urban centers, university towns, regions with dynamic job markets, rich cultural offerings and entertainment facilities. These regions also tend to have a younger demographic.

Health

Across the UK, the average 48.4% rated their health as Very Good, 33.6% as Good, 12.7% as Fair, 4% as Bad, and 1.2% as Very Bad.

Population age significantly impacts residents' health. Additionally, socioeconomic status plays a crucial role: higher income levels and lower poverty rates are linked to better health outcomes. Affluent areas benefit from higher living standards, access to private healthcare, and healthier lifestyle choices.

This area has a high percentage of residents reporting their health as Good or Very Good (87.3%) compared to the average (82%). This typically indicates either a younger population or more affluent area.

Safety

Is Esslemont Road d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Esslemont Road was 17.5 per 1,000 residents, which is 80.4% lower than the Central Southsea average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Esslemont Road has the 4th lowest crime rate of 45 local areas in Central Southsea and the 49th lowest crime rate of 588 local areas in Portsmouth .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 13.2 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-7.7%.

Employment

PO4 0ES area has a high level of entrepreneurship. Only 22% of streets have higher percent of entrepreneur residents. 12% of population in this area is self-employed, while the average in the UK is 9.7%. High number of entrepreneurs usually leads to relatively high economic growth, higher paid jobs and better quality of life in the area.

PO4 0ES area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 2%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.

The percentage of student residents living in PO4 0ES area is much higher than the country's average. Usually places with high percentage of students are near Universities and near entertainment places.
